A critical analysis of MBTI-based personality profiling with large language models
Jean Marie Tshimula1,2, René Manassé Galekwa2,3, Belkacem Chikhaoui1
1Applied Artificial Intelligence Institute, Université TÉLUQ, Montreal, Canada.
Large Language Models (LLMs) show limited accuracy in predicting human personality using Myers-Briggs Type Indicator (MBTI) frameworks. Current AI personality assessments face challenges with data bias, model calibration, and the fundamental concept of AI personality.

Background:
- The Myers-Briggs Type Indicator (MBTI) is widely used for personality profiling.
- Large Language Models (LLMs) are increasingly explored for their potential in understanding and simulating human cognition, including personality.
Purpose of the Study:
- To critically analyze the efficacy and limitations of using LLMs for MBTI-based personality profiling.
- To evaluate LLMs both as tools for inferring human personality and as subjects assessed by psychometric frameworks.
Main Methods:
- Review of recent research (2020-2025) on LLM applications in personality assessment.
- Analysis of various LLM approaches including traditional machine learning, fine-tuned transformers, and zero-shot prompting.
- Examination of performance across diverse datasets (Kaggle MBTI, PersonalityCafe, Pandora, MBTIBench) and evaluation using soft labels.
Main Results:
- Top LLM systems achieve 75%-85% accuracy at the dichotomy level, but improvements over baselines are often modest and dataset-dependent.
- LLMs exhibit systematic issues like polarized predictions, overconfidence, and poor calibration.
- LLMs demonstrate reproducible but context-dependent 'personality-like' profiles, often skewed towards socially desirable traits due to alignment training.
Conclusions:
- MBTI-based LLM personality modeling is hindered by the MBTI's psychometric limitations, weaknesses in self-reported data, and the philosophical ambiguity of AI personality.
- Ethical risks and evaluation gaps necessitate more rigorous, calibrated, and theoretically grounded approaches to AI personality modeling.
